Well I can honestly say that stopping smoking has been one of the most positive things I have EVER done. I am at day 41 now and feel fine, no cravings and my emotions seem to have settled down to almost normal. I have saved £235 and not smoked 835 cigarettes!!!! Weeks 2 and 3 were sh*te if I'm honest but all is good now.

I think it was really important for me to do this cold turkey as I really believe that using any of the nrt methods is just prolonging the agony of actually getting off nicotine for good. I know everyone is different but I'm sure I would still be smoking now if I hadn't gone ct.

Hope everyone else is doing ok.
